**Q: Why is the thumbnail queue backed up again?**

Usually it's one giant video upload hogging the Pixelforge workers — the queue is FIFO and big transcodes block everything behind them. Quick fix: bump the oversized job to the slow lane and the backlog clears in minutes. Queue depth, worker counts, and the slow-lane toggle are all on the dashboard page.

operations page: https://jenkins.zemvarcloud.local/job/merge_requests/repo/build/73930b4b30f0a8ed

## Deployment

SproutClock runs as a single container behind the Fernhollow reverse proxy. It requires outbound access only to the valve controller subnet and the weather feed; no inbound ports beyond 8443 are opened. Secrets are injected at start via the orchestrator, never baked into the image. The scheduler runs as a non-root user and writes solely to its state volume. For review purposes, the deployed configuration values are listed below.

service settings:
[silwyn]
host = silwyn.crelvogrid.internal
user = silwyn_svc
database = silwyn_prod

Hey, welcome to the Brindle on-call rotation! Quick heads-up: we're mid-investigation on cron drift affecting the nightly Tollgate jobs — some fire up to twelve minutes late after host restarts. It's annoying but not urgent; just note timestamps if you see it. Everything we've found so far, plus mitigation steps, is written up on the page below.

operations page: https://confluence.qorvellabs.internal/pages/projects/projects/projects

Quick note on Feedwren, our podcast feed validator: it polls publisher feeds every 15 minutes and flags malformed enclosures in the triage channel. If validation stalls, bounce the poller — state is rebuilt from the last checkpoint, so nothing's lost. Config is read once at startup. The API token it uses to fetch gated feeds sits on the very next line.

vault entry, kahip-fahog: RELAY_SECRET20=6a2c791de808f35c3b55